Today I discuss How To Be A Confident Teenager with international speaker, and bestselling author on change, resilience, motivation and leadership Paul McGee (aka The Sumo Guy).

With there being a gap between what young people learn at school and what they learn at home Paul's recent book Yesss The SUMO Secrets to being a Positive, Confident, Teenager plugs this gap at the same time as developing self awareness, critical thinking, and emotional intelligence.

Paul and I discuss the following in our conversation:

The societal pressures on young people to be academically successful and not failThe SUMO method that he teaches and how teenagers can apply this to their lives.The unique challenges that teenagers face in dealing with their 'blue' and 'red' rational and emotional brains during adolescence.Some useful acronyms that teenagers (and adults) can use to harness powerful changes to emotional intelligence, critical thinking and self awareness
